Water in phosphate laser glasses and its removal
Six infrared absorption bands caused by Jwater in phosphate glasses were identified. The relationship between the absorption coefficient at 3.47m due to water and fluorescence lifetime of Nd3+ weve determined. The variation of water contents during melting was measured in detail and the result showed that it increased obviously after stopping dry gas bubbling. The BAP has been used to remove the water in phosphate laser glass and it is easy to fabricate a glass with K3.47μmOH=1.
